軟件測(cè)評(píng)師測(cè)試用例設(shè)計(jì)原則與技巧_第1頁(yè)
軟件測(cè)評(píng)師測(cè)試用例設(shè)計(jì)原則與技巧_第2頁(yè)
軟件測(cè)評(píng)師測(cè)試用例設(shè)計(jì)原則與技巧_第3頁(yè)
軟件測(cè)評(píng)師測(cè)試用例設(shè)計(jì)原則與技巧_第4頁(yè)
軟件測(cè)評(píng)師測(cè)試用例設(shè)計(jì)原則與技巧_第5頁(yè)
已閱讀5頁(yè),還剩24頁(yè)未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

軟件測(cè)評(píng)師測(cè)試用例設(shè)計(jì)原則與技巧場(chǎng)景化測(cè)試用例設(shè)計(jì)方法論述測(cè)試用例設(shè)計(jì)技巧測(cè)試用例設(shè)計(jì)原則測(cè)試用例設(shè)計(jì)基礎(chǔ)自動(dòng)化在測(cè)試用例設(shè)計(jì)中應(yīng)用探討總結(jié)回顧與未來(lái)趨勢(shì)展望目錄65432101測(cè)試用例設(shè)計(jì)基礎(chǔ)測(cè)試用例是為特定的測(cè)試目標(biāo)(如功能、性能、安全等)而設(shè)計(jì)的一組輸入、執(zhí)行條件和預(yù)期結(jié)果的集合,是測(cè)試執(zhí)行的基礎(chǔ)和依據(jù)。通過(guò)測(cè)試用例可以檢驗(yàn)軟件是否滿足規(guī)定的需求,發(fā)現(xiàn)軟件中的缺陷,為軟件質(zhì)量評(píng)估提供依據(jù),同時(shí)保證測(cè)試的系統(tǒng)性和全面性。定義作用測(cè)試用例定義及作用03在實(shí)際測(cè)試過(guò)程中,測(cè)試用例可能需要根據(jù)測(cè)試需求的變更進(jìn)行相應(yīng)的調(diào)整和優(yōu)化。01測(cè)試需求是測(cè)試用例設(shè)計(jì)的前提和基礎(chǔ),測(cè)試用例是測(cè)試需求的具體化和實(shí)現(xiàn)。02測(cè)試用例設(shè)計(jì)需要充分考慮測(cè)試需求,確保每個(gè)測(cè)試需求都有相應(yīng)的測(cè)試用例來(lái)覆蓋。測(cè)試用例與測(cè)試需求關(guān)系可重復(fù)性優(yōu)秀的測(cè)試用例應(yīng)該能夠在相同的環(huán)境下重復(fù)執(zhí)行,并且每次執(zhí)行的結(jié)果應(yīng)該是一致的??删S護(hù)性隨著軟件需求的變更,測(cè)試用例應(yīng)能夠方便地進(jìn)行修改和維護(hù),以適應(yīng)新的測(cè)試需求。簡(jiǎn)潔性測(cè)試用例設(shè)計(jì)應(yīng)簡(jiǎn)潔明了,避免冗余和復(fù)雜的步驟,提高測(cè)試執(zhí)行效率。全面性優(yōu)秀的測(cè)試用例應(yīng)該能夠全面覆蓋測(cè)試需求,包括正常和異常情況,以及邊界條件等。準(zhǔn)確性測(cè)試用例中的輸入數(shù)據(jù)和預(yù)期結(jié)果必須準(zhǔn)確無(wú)誤,以確保測(cè)試的有效性和可靠性。優(yōu)秀測(cè)試用例標(biāo)準(zhǔn)02測(cè)試用例設(shè)計(jì)原則確保所有功能點(diǎn)均被測(cè)試覆蓋,無(wú)遺漏。對(duì)每個(gè)功能進(jìn)行細(xì)分,設(shè)計(jì)針對(duì)各功能細(xì)節(jié)的測(cè)試用例??紤]功能的實(shí)際使用場(chǎng)景,設(shè)計(jì)貼近用戶實(shí)際操作的測(cè)試用例。全面覆蓋功能需求深入了解用戶需求,從用戶角度出發(fā)設(shè)計(jì)測(cè)試用例。針對(duì)用戶關(guān)注的核心功能和性能指標(biāo),設(shè)計(jì)高價(jià)值的測(cè)試用例。結(jié)合用戶反饋,不斷優(yōu)化和調(diào)整測(cè)試用例?;谟脩粜枨笤O(shè)計(jì)設(shè)計(jì)針對(duì)系統(tǒng)異常情況的測(cè)試用例,如網(wǎng)絡(luò)異常、數(shù)據(jù)異常等??紤]系統(tǒng)容錯(cuò)能力,對(duì)可能出現(xiàn)的錯(cuò)誤進(jìn)行預(yù)設(shè)并設(shè)計(jì)相應(yīng)的測(cè)試用例。對(duì)輸入輸出的邊界條件進(jìn)行充分測(cè)試,確保系統(tǒng)在邊界情況下能正確處理。邊界條件及異常情況考慮為測(cè)試用例提供清晰的執(zhí)行步驟和預(yù)期結(jié)果,便于重復(fù)執(zhí)行和驗(yàn)證。對(duì)測(cè)試用例進(jìn)行定期評(píng)審和更新,確保其始終與系統(tǒng)需求保持一致。同時(shí),隨著系統(tǒng)更新或需求變更,及時(shí)對(duì)測(cè)試用例進(jìn)行相應(yīng)調(diào)整和維護(hù)。設(shè)計(jì)易于理解和執(zhí)行的測(cè)試用例,降低執(zhí)行難度??芍貜?fù)性與可維護(hù)性保障03測(cè)試用例設(shè)計(jì)技巧將輸入數(shù)據(jù)劃分為若干個(gè)等價(jià)類,從每個(gè)等價(jià)類中選取一個(gè)或多個(gè)代表性數(shù)據(jù)進(jìn)行測(cè)試。確定等價(jià)類滿足需求規(guī)格說(shuō)明的、合理的輸入數(shù)據(jù)集合,用于驗(yàn)證程序是否實(shí)現(xiàn)了預(yù)期功能。有效等價(jià)類不滿足需求規(guī)格說(shuō)明的、不合理的輸入數(shù)據(jù)集合,用于驗(yàn)證程序是否具備異常處理能力。無(wú)效等價(jià)類在測(cè)試用戶登錄功能時(shí),可將用戶名和密碼劃分為有效等價(jià)類和無(wú)效等價(jià)類,分別進(jìn)行測(cè)試。示例應(yīng)用等價(jià)類劃分法應(yīng)用示例確定邊界值上點(diǎn)、內(nèi)點(diǎn)和離點(diǎn)遵循原則實(shí)踐應(yīng)用邊界值分析法實(shí)踐要點(diǎn)01020304選取輸入數(shù)據(jù)的邊界值作為測(cè)試用例,因?yàn)檫吔缰堤幾钊菀桩a(chǎn)生錯(cuò)誤。對(duì)于每個(gè)邊界值,分別測(cè)試剛好等于、剛好小于和剛好大于邊界值的情況。確保每個(gè)邊界值都被測(cè)試到,同時(shí)要注意邊界值之間的組合情況。在測(cè)試一個(gè)數(shù)值范圍輸入框時(shí),可針對(duì)其最小值、最大值及邊界值附近的值進(jìn)行測(cè)試。使用圖形化方式描述輸入與輸出之間的因果關(guān)系,便于分析和理解復(fù)雜邏輯。因果圖法判定表法簡(jiǎn)化邏輯適用場(chǎng)景將因果圖轉(zhuǎn)化為表格形式,列出所有可能的輸入組合及對(duì)應(yīng)的輸出結(jié)果,便于編寫測(cè)試用例。通過(guò)因果圖和判定表可以簡(jiǎn)化復(fù)雜的邏輯判斷,避免遺漏測(cè)試點(diǎn)。適用于具有多種輸入條件、輸出結(jié)果受多個(gè)條件影響的測(cè)試場(chǎng)景。因果圖法及判定表法簡(jiǎn)介正交實(shí)驗(yàn)設(shè)計(jì)法原理剖析正交性確保所有參數(shù)組合都被均勻地測(cè)試到,同時(shí)減少不必要的重復(fù)測(cè)試。正交表根據(jù)參數(shù)數(shù)量和取值范圍選擇合適的正交表,用于指導(dǎo)測(cè)試用例設(shè)計(jì)。均勻分散與整齊可比正交實(shí)驗(yàn)設(shè)計(jì)法能夠確保測(cè)試用例在參數(shù)空間內(nèi)均勻分散,同時(shí)便于對(duì)測(cè)試結(jié)果進(jìn)行整齊可比的分析。原理應(yīng)用在測(cè)試具有多個(gè)參數(shù)的功能時(shí),可采用正交實(shí)驗(yàn)設(shè)計(jì)法來(lái)減少測(cè)試用例數(shù)量,提高測(cè)試效率。04場(chǎng)景化測(cè)試用例設(shè)計(jì)方法論述場(chǎng)景化測(cè)試定義01場(chǎng)景化測(cè)試是一種以用戶場(chǎng)景為出發(fā)點(diǎn),通過(guò)模擬用戶實(shí)際操作行為和路徑來(lái)進(jìn)行軟件測(cè)試的方法。場(chǎng)景化測(cè)試目的02旨在發(fā)現(xiàn)軟件在實(shí)際使用場(chǎng)景中可能存在的問(wèn)題,提高軟件的質(zhì)量和用戶體驗(yàn)。場(chǎng)景化測(cè)試與其他測(cè)試方法的區(qū)別03與傳統(tǒng)的功能測(cè)試、性能測(cè)試等相比,場(chǎng)景化測(cè)試更注重用戶實(shí)際使用場(chǎng)景,更貼近用戶真實(shí)需求。場(chǎng)景化測(cè)試概念引入典型場(chǎng)景識(shí)別根據(jù)軟件的功能特點(diǎn)、用戶群體和使用環(huán)境等因素,識(shí)別出軟件使用過(guò)程中典型的、具有代表性的場(chǎng)景。場(chǎng)景描述方法采用簡(jiǎn)潔明了的語(yǔ)言描述場(chǎng)景,包括場(chǎng)景的背景、用戶角色、操作行為、期望結(jié)果等信息,便于測(cè)試人員理解和執(zhí)行測(cè)試。場(chǎng)景分類與優(yōu)先級(jí)劃分根據(jù)場(chǎng)景的重要程度和使用頻率,對(duì)場(chǎng)景進(jìn)行分類和優(yōu)先級(jí)劃分,確保測(cè)試工作的重點(diǎn)和效率。典型場(chǎng)景識(shí)別和描述方法用例編寫原則遵循“全面覆蓋、簡(jiǎn)潔明了、易于維護(hù)”的原則,確保測(cè)試用例能夠全面覆蓋典型場(chǎng)景,同時(shí)簡(jiǎn)潔易懂,便于后續(xù)維護(hù)。用例設(shè)計(jì)技巧采用等價(jià)類劃分、邊界值分析等方法,設(shè)計(jì)具有代表性和針對(duì)性的測(cè)試用例,提高測(cè)試效率和準(zhǔn)確性。用例執(zhí)行與跟蹤按照測(cè)試用例執(zhí)行測(cè)試,并記錄測(cè)試結(jié)果和問(wèn)題,及時(shí)反饋和跟蹤問(wèn)題處理情況,確保測(cè)試工作的有效性和質(zhì)量。同時(shí),定期對(duì)測(cè)試用例進(jìn)行復(fù)審和更新,以適應(yīng)軟件需求的變化。場(chǎng)景化測(cè)試用例編寫技巧分享05自動(dòng)化在測(cè)試用例設(shè)計(jì)中應(yīng)用探討定義與概述常見(jiàn)類型框架選擇依據(jù)自動(dòng)化測(cè)試框架簡(jiǎn)介自動(dòng)化測(cè)試框架是為實(shí)現(xiàn)自動(dòng)化測(cè)試而設(shè)計(jì)的一套系統(tǒng),包括測(cè)試管理、測(cè)試腳本開(kāi)發(fā)、測(cè)試執(zhí)行、結(jié)果分析等模塊。線性腳本框架、模塊化測(cè)試框架、數(shù)據(jù)驅(qū)動(dòng)框架、關(guān)鍵字驅(qū)動(dòng)框架等,各有優(yōu)缺點(diǎn),需根據(jù)實(shí)際情況選擇。測(cè)試需求、團(tuán)隊(duì)技能、項(xiàng)目周期、成本預(yù)算等因素綜合考慮。01020304腳本結(jié)構(gòu)清晰合理劃分測(cè)試腳本模塊,便于閱讀和維護(hù)。命名規(guī)范統(tǒng)一變量、函數(shù)、類等命名需遵循一定規(guī)范,提高代碼可讀性。注釋詳細(xì)準(zhǔn)確關(guān)鍵部分需添加注釋,解釋代碼功能和實(shí)現(xiàn)邏輯。異常處理完善針對(duì)可能出現(xiàn)的異常情況,編寫相應(yīng)的處理邏輯,提高腳本穩(wěn)定性。自動(dòng)化腳本編寫規(guī)范指導(dǎo)提高測(cè)試效率自動(dòng)化測(cè)試可快速執(zhí)行大量測(cè)試用例,縮短回歸測(cè)試周期。降低人力成本減少重復(fù)的手工測(cè)試工作,節(jié)省人力資源。保障測(cè)試質(zhì)量自動(dòng)化測(cè)試可準(zhǔn)確執(zhí)行預(yù)設(shè)的測(cè)試用例,避免人為因素導(dǎo)致的測(cè)試遺漏或錯(cuò)誤。持續(xù)改進(jìn)優(yōu)化通過(guò)對(duì)自動(dòng)化測(cè)試結(jié)果的收集和分析,可不斷完善測(cè)試用例設(shè)計(jì),提高測(cè)試覆蓋率。自動(dòng)化在回歸測(cè)試中價(jià)值體現(xiàn)01總結(jié)回顧與未來(lái)趨勢(shì)展望測(cè)試用例設(shè)計(jì)基礎(chǔ)了解測(cè)試用例設(shè)計(jì)的核心概念和原則,包括測(cè)試用例的構(gòu)成、設(shè)計(jì)方法及評(píng)審流程等。灰盒測(cè)試用例設(shè)計(jì)熟悉灰盒測(cè)試用例設(shè)計(jì)的思路,包括模塊接口測(cè)試、狀態(tài)轉(zhuǎn)換測(cè)試等,以及在實(shí)際項(xiàng)目中的運(yùn)用。黑盒測(cè)試用例設(shè)計(jì)掌握黑盒測(cè)試用例設(shè)計(jì)的技巧,如等價(jià)類劃分、邊界值分析、因果圖等,以及針對(duì)不同類型軟件的具體應(yīng)用方法。白盒測(cè)試用例設(shè)計(jì)深入理解白盒測(cè)試用例設(shè)計(jì)的原理,如路徑覆蓋、條件覆蓋等,提升代碼層面的測(cè)試能力。關(guān)鍵知識(shí)點(diǎn)總結(jié)回顧隨著人工智能技術(shù)的不斷發(fā)展,智能化測(cè)試將成為未來(lái)軟件測(cè)評(píng)的重要方向,包括智能測(cè)試用例生成、智能缺陷定位等。智能化測(cè)試技術(shù)自動(dòng)化測(cè)試框架將越來(lái)越完善,支持更廣泛的測(cè)試場(chǎng)景,提高測(cè)試效率和準(zhǔn)確性。自動(dòng)化測(cè)試框架云測(cè)試服務(wù)平臺(tái)將進(jìn)一步普及,為企業(yè)提供更加便捷、高效的測(cè)試解決方案,降低測(cè)試成本。云測(cè)試服務(wù)平臺(tái)行業(yè)發(fā)展趨勢(shì)分析深入學(xué)習(xí)測(cè)試?yán)碚摬粩鄬W(xué)習(xí)和掌握新

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論